High-Level Talks to Expand UAE-US Collaborations
His Majesty During high-level talks with Trump administration officials Monday, Sheikh Tahnoon bin Zayed Al Nahyan, the National Security Advisor and Deputy Ruler of Abu Dhabi, stressed the need of expanding economic and scientific cooperation with the United States.
Strengthening Ties with Tech Giants
Sheikh Tahnoon spoke with senior leaders from top tech companies, such as Microsoft, Amazon, Palantir, Oracle, BlackRock, NVIDIA, and xAI, during his official visit. The gatherings highlight the UAE’s determination to increase its investment presence in the US and cultivate alliances in the fields of advanced technology, energy, infrastructure, life sciences, and artificial intelligence.
Reinforcing Strategic Alliances
The visit also aims to further strengthen the longstanding strategic alliance between the two nations. UAE Ambassador to the US, Yousef Al Otaiba, reaffirmed this commitment, stating, “The US remains our key partner in these and other sectors – we have ambitious plans to do even more in and with the US.”
White House Engagements on Economic Growth
Dr. Sultan Ahmed Al Jaber, Minister of Industry and Advanced Technology, along with Ambassador Al Otaiba, held discussions at the White House with US Vice President JD Vance. The UAE Embassy in the US shared an update on social media, highlighting that the talks focused on deepening collaboration in energy investment, technological leadership, and economic growth.
